Quick Quack

By MOBspree, Inc.

This video was uploaded from an Android phone.
This is the official Android App of Quick Quack Car Wash, a growing chain of exterior-only, soft cloth car washes in California, Texas & Colorado.
More
(16)
500 - 1k
12 years ago